SiteMapNode.NextSibling Propriété

Définition

Obtient le nœud SiteMapNode suivant sur le même niveau hiérarchique que le nœud actuel, selon la propriété ParentNode (si elle existe).Gets the next SiteMapNode node on the same hierarchical level as the current one, relative to the ParentNode property (if one exists).

public:
 virtual property System::Web::SiteMapNode ^ NextSibling { System::Web::SiteMapNode ^ get(); };
public virtual System.Web.SiteMapNode NextSibling { get; }
member this.NextSibling : System.Web.SiteMapNode
Public Overridable ReadOnly Property NextSibling As SiteMapNode

Valeur de propriété

SiteMapNode

Le SiteMapNode qui suit l'actuel nœud, de manière séquentielle, sous le nœud parent ; sinon, null, si aucun parent n'existe, si ce nœud n'est suivi d'aucun autre, ou si l'ajustement de la sécurité est activé et empêche l'utilisateur d'afficher les nœuds parents ou les nœuds frères suivants.The next SiteMapNode, serially, after the current one, under the parent node; otherwise, null, if no parent exists, there is no node that follows this one, or security trimming is enabled and the user cannot view the parent or next sibling nodes.

Remarques

La propriété NextSibling suppose que l’objet SiteMapProvider implémente ses collections internes de telle sorte que lorsqu’un nœud parent récupère sa propriété ChildNodes, les nœuds se trouvent dans le même ordre que celui dans lequel ils apparaissent dans le plan du site.The NextSibling property presumes that the SiteMapProvider object implements its internal collections such that when a parent node retrieves its ChildNodes property, the nodes are in the same order as they appear in the site map. Si vous utilisez .NET Framework classes de collection dans une implémentation d’un fournisseur de plan de site, choisissez les collections qui implémentent l’interface IList, telles que les classes ArrayList ou ListDictionary.If you use .NET Framework collection classes in an implementation of a site map provider, choose collections that implement the IList interface, such as the ArrayList or ListDictionary classes. Si vous choisissez des regroupements qui n’implémentent pas l’interface IList, tels que la classe Hashtable, des résultats inattendus peuvent se produire pour des opérations de navigation de site simples.If you choose collections that do not implement the IList interface, such as the Hashtable class, unexpected results can occur for simple site navigation operations.

S’applique à

Voir aussi